Transaction 02768bdddf91fa54635bd623dec4b278029bbae2d596e882403462d54b36ecf5

1 Input
2 Outputs
  • 02768bdddf91fa54635bd623dec4b278029bbae2d596e882403462d54b36ecf5:0
  • value  469999
    address  3Az3uzXsBeCCh7Z1vvHrEZnaQiKDTCPeSq
  • 02768bdddf91fa54635bd623dec4b278029bbae2d596e882403462d54b36ecf5:1
  • value  19525521
    address  1MUZKrqhTw8SgVvq4ir7QahKfgpnCmE3qg